Frequently Asked Questions
What is the graduation rate of Cascade High School?
The graduation rate of Cascade High School is 80%, which is lower than the California state average of 88%.
How many students attend Cascade High School?
5 students attend Cascade High School.
What is the racial composition of the student body?
60% of Cascade High School students are Hispanic, and 40% of students are White.
What grades does Cascade High School offer ?
Cascade High School offers enrollment in grades 9-12
What school district is Cascade High School part of?
Cascade High School is part of Butte Valley Unified School District.
